## TileForge Cache — Flush Procedure

Before each release, drain the TileForge render cache on the Quillhaven cluster. Stop the warmer, flush shard groups in order, restart. Do not skip the drain; stale tiles will pin old styles for hours. Verify hit-rate recovery above 85% before sign-off. The active cache settings for the current release are listed below.

config for kafof-bawef:
holath:
  log_level: debug
  metrics_host: metrics.holath.qorvelsys.internal
  pin: 2191
  pool_size: 32

# Environments — Canary Gating (Project Birchmoor)

Hey, welcome! Quick rundown: every release hits the canary ring first, where it bakes for a set window while we watch error rate and latency deltas. If either gate trips, promotion halts automatically — no heroics, no manual overrides without a lead's sign-off. The gating thresholds and bake timings currently in force are as follows.

service settings:
PRAIX_LOG_LEVEL=error
PRAIX_METRICS_HOST=metrics.praix.qorvelcorp.corp
PRAIX_POOL_SIZE=16

☐ **Archive run — paper ledgers to Welbridge store**

Before accepting the consignment, confirm all twelve ledger boxes are strapped, labelled by year, and listed on the transfer sheet in sequence. Any box with a broken strap must be refused and noted, not repaired on site. Ledgers go directly to the climate-controlled bay; do not stage them in the loading corridor overnight. When the courier presents the consignment, the receiving clerk must follow this confidential instruction:

handover note for yagef-bagep: the drudor pelius courier leaves the kasdor zorvan norir ledger at gate 8016 under passcode 755406

// Weekly sync note: the Pixelforge thumbnail cache leaks ~40MB/hr
// under burst load. Evictions never fire because the LRU counter
// resets on config reload. Fix lands in the next Quartzline release;
// until then we bounce the worker nightly. Client below talks to the
// internal Rastermint service and needs its key on the next line.

app token of kajop-tahag = qvz23-qaEp6MzrfP2AwhVbZwsZeUq